French Armament General Directorate takes delivery of H225M helicopters 

The French Armament General Directorate (DGA) has taken delivery of the first two H225M helicopters from Airbus. These helicopters are part of an order for eight placed in 2021. Hi Fly ferries first Global Airlines’ A380 to Portugal

The Hi Fly team has successfully ferried the first Global Airlines Airbus A380-841, registered as 9H-GLOBL, from Dresden, Germany, to Beja, Portugal, over a distance of 1,240 nautical miles. Challenge Group to lease two Boeing 777-300ERSFs from AerCap

Challenge Group announced at a press conference at its headquarters in Malta last week, its leasing of two additional Boeing 777-300ERSF converted freighters from AerCap.
